Search Everything

Login

Send feeback or report a bug here

Send feeback or report a bug here

Thariode: The Lost City
Thariode: The Lost City

Thariode: The Lost City

0
0.0

Watch Trailer

Based on the 2019 documentary film "Thariode" by Nirmal Baby Varghese.